Sophie

Sophie

distrib > Mageia > 4 > x86_64 > by-pkgid > e84315141170f9b2b0796233d01d9230 > files > 1073

kde-l10n-handbooks-ca-4.11.4-1.mga4.noarch.rpm

<?xml version="1.0"  encoding="UTF-8" ?>

<chapter id="introduction">
<chapterinfo>
<title
>Introducció</title>
<authorgroup>
<author
><firstname
>Eric</firstname
> <surname
>Laffoon</surname
> <affiliation
> <address
><email
>sequitur@kde.org</email
></address>
</affiliation>
</author>

&traductor.Antoni.Bella; 

</authorgroup>
</chapterinfo>

<title
>Introducció</title>

<para
>&kommander; és una eina de construcció de diàleg visual que es pot ampliar per crear aplicacions de finestra principal completes. L'objectiu principal és crear la funcionalitat tant com sigui possible sense utilitzar cap llenguatge d'script. Això és proporcionat per les següents característiques: </para>

<itemizedlist>


<listitem
><para
>Els especials estan precedits per una <quote
>@</quote
> com @widgetText. Ofereixen característiques especials com el valor d'un estri, funcions, àlies, variables globals i demés.</para
></listitem>


<listitem
><para
>La integració de &DCOP; permet als diàlegs de &kommander; controlar i ser controlats en les interaccions amb d'altres aplicacions del &kde;. És una característica molt poderosa!</para
></listitem>

<listitem
><para
>Les senyals i ranures són una mica menys intuïtives per a un nou usuari. S'està revisant com processar les coses en la propera versió major. Ofereixen un model d'esdeveniment limitat per a quan es prem un botó o es canvia un estri. En combinació amb el <quote
>Text de població</quote
> són força poderoses.</para
></listitem>
</itemizedlist>

<para
>La característica clau dels diàlegs de &kommander; és que poden enllaçar text (Text &kommander;) a un estri. De manera que si teniu @widget1 i @widget2 i són línies d'edició podreu establir que &kommander; mostri el seu contingut mitjançant la introducció de @widgetText en la seva àrea de text del &kommander;. A continuació introduïu «hola» a @widget1 i «món» a @widget2. Un botó pot tenir la cadena «El meu primer programa @widget1 @widget2 al &kommander;». Si executeu aquest diàleg des d'una consola sortirà «El meu primer programa hola món al &kommander;». </para>

<para
>Esperem que comenceu a veure una petita espurna del potencial. &kommander; permet un model de disseny molt més ràpid per a aplicacions simples ja que permet deixar de pensar tant sobre el llenguatge i revertir al model conceptual més bàsic i natural. En el llenguatge dels ordinadors és un mitjà per definir conceptes i, com a tal, és una capa entre el concepte i la implementació que pot impedir el progrés amb minúcies. &kommander; busca minimitzar aquesta capa. </para>

<para
>&kommander; també pretén construir sobre els estàndards. Es basa en el marc de treball &Qt; Designer i crea fitxers *.ui que reanomena a *.kmdr. Es poden importar amb facilitat a qualsevol estri del &kde; i això es pot fer sense haver de reconstruir &kommander;, utilitzant connectors. </para>

<para
>Un altre factor important de &kommander; és la manera com aborda els requisits del llenguatge. Els llenguatges de programació poden ser meravellosos, però tendeixen a tenir els seus propis dogmes i fanàtics sovint tracten de proporcionar un avanç al disseny de la &IGU; en un entorn de desenvolupament integrat. Irònicament, l'acceptació d'aquest &IDE; està limitat pel nombre de persones disposades a adoptar un nou llenguatge per accedir a una característica desitjada. En realitat, no és raonable esperar que la gent hagi de canviar a una dotzena de llenguatges per accedir a diversos conjunts de característiques. Donat que es tracta d'un llenguatge neutral i permet que un diàleg de &kommander; s'estengui utilitzant qualsevol llenguatge d'script, &kommander; es posiciona com una opció d'ample espectre. Es poden utilitzar múltiples llenguatges d'script en un mateix diàleg i les aplicacions es poden modificar utilitzant un llenguatge diferent de l'emprat pel desenvolupador original i poc a poc convertint i ampliant el mateix. Els nous estris i característiques estaran disponibles immediatament per a tots els llenguatges disponibles. </para>

<para
>Esperem que &kommander; comenci a rebre el suport dels desenvolupadors i el reconeixement necessari per assolir el potencial que ofereix. El nostre objectiu final és fer &kommander; útil per als usuaris novells per estendre i combinar les seves aplicacions. Alhora, s'hauria de convertir en una bona eina de prototipat. També obre la porta a la promesa de codi obert com una nova via. Sabem que la gent pot estendre els nostres programes sota llicència GPL, però el fet és que continuen sent molt pocs els que tenen les habilitats necessàries. Amb &kommander; aquests números es veuran multiplicats! Algunes aplicacions poden ser més lògiques com una aplicació de &kommander;. Ja l'estem utilitzant en àrees en les que volem permetre l'extensibilitat de &quantaplus;. </para>

<para
>Esperem que gaudiu de &kommander;. Si us plau, ajudeu amb informes d'error i diàlegs d'exemple, així com qualsevol petició que pugueu tenir. Podeu unir-vos a la nostra llista d'usuaris per ajudar en el desenvolupament d'aplicacions de &kommander; a http://mail.kdewebdev.org/mailman/listinfo/kommander </para>

<para
>Salutacions cordials des de l'equip de desenvolupament de &kommander;!</para>

</chapter>